Use an effective caching plugin-
WordPress plugins are obviously quite useful to extend functions, but some of the best fall under the caching plugin category, as they drastically improve page loads time, and best of all, all of them on WordPress.org plugin archive are free and easy to use.
I suggest you to use WP-Super-Cache plugin, its published by Automattic (WordPress). So it is more trustworthy then others. Just install, activate and apply simple mode to enable quick cache in WordPress.
Optimizes and Compress your website CSS and JavaScript code-
Cache is useful for server level optimization, but Website CSS and JavaScript Optimization helps to reduce page size. There is a plugin call Autoptimize By Frank Goossens (futtta), that is very powerful and improve page loading time.
Use a CDN (content delivery network)-
CDN, or content delivery network, takes all your static files you’ve got on your site (CSS, Javascript and images etc) and lets visitors download them as fast as possible by serving the files on servers as close to them as possible. CDN is a cloud that server data from multiple location.
Personally I’m using Cloudflare, Its very fast and reliable. Through cloudflare you can serve your whole site from CDN network, html too.
Optimize images through plugin automatically-
Yahoo! has an image optimizer called Smush.it that will drastically reduce the file size of an image, while not reducing quality. There is an amazing, free plugin called WP-SmushIt which will do this process to all of your images automatically, as you are uploading them.
Optimize your WordPress database-
Sometimes problems in your MySQL database can slowdown your WordPress website, There is a plugin lets you do just one simple task: optimize the your database (spam, post revisions, drafts, tables, etc.) to reduce their overhead. You can simply use the WP-Optimize plugin. There is also a plugin called WP-DB Manager plugin, which can schedule dates for database optimization.
Use less WP Plugins-
WordPress plugins is very useful, but it makes your WordPress more heavy by adding unwanted scripts and CSS files. Its good to use only important plugins. If you need some features, you can create your own custom plugin.
